abstract = {Routing the video requests in the portable network is a challenging issue. The placement of contents is a very complex task. There are two main problems need to be focused. First is how to select a particular server among multiple servers to issue requests called as server selection. Second is how the so-generated video flows are transmitted known as flow routing. These problems can be termed as traffic engineering objectives, namely, minimizing maximum link utilization and total link cost.To overcome these problems Built-in content caches are implemented. These caches are incorporated in the serving gateways thereby overcoming the problem of content placement and improving the speed.},
